How do you moisturize the braided hair underneath a weave? I was planning on putting Frenchee's on the scalp and s-curl and mango butter on the cornrows underneath my weave once a week. How often should I wash my hair too w/ this weave. It's sewn-in w/ human hair. All suggestions are welcome!
 
i washed mine twice a week, just be careful of tangles. i would put the weave into 4 ponytail buns so that i fully washed my scalp. i moisturized with s-curl, WGO, and ORS Olive oil.
 
I just got a full head weave too! I brought some WGO and I have been applying it to the scapl between the tracks. It is so heavy and the smell can get on your nerves. i sugggest not putting too much. I was doing every other night, I think this is too much. I am going to cut to 3 time a week the most. As for the actual braid, I am going to spray S-Curl or care free curl on it. You have to be so careful as to not weigh down the weave hair. As far as washing, I hav been wondering myself. I was going to go to the dominicans and get a wash and set every 2 weeks. I don't want the weave hair to thin out too much. You know it will shed the more you do with it. I am thinkin of wiping my scalp with astringent in between washes. I wouldn't use Frenchees girl. It will stay in that hair and the smell will make you lose your mind. The WGO isn't as bad. Let me know how it goes. I am going for a wash this week after having the weave for two weeks now. If anyone this I need to change my regimine, don't hestiate to comment on my post. Also wondering, what shampoo and conditioner would you ladies sugggest on a weave? Mine is sewn in as well.
 
when i washed my hair with a weave, i put the hair up into 4 ponytail buns and then i washed my hair like the crown and glory method says. pouring a cap full in a cup and mixing with water.
 
I only use oil. Occasionally, I pour some Infusium leave-in under there, but that's about it.
